This robot has the digitized brain of a worm in it and it functions autonomously. Here’s what it means for the future of AI.
Worms are weird, primitive creatures that seem to just squirm around senselessly. However, this simplistic behavior is exactly what we are looking for in our endeavours to digitize a living brain.
Researchers recently managed to put a copy of the brain of a Caenorhabditis elegans, or C. elegans into a robot. It is the digital brain of a worm on a computer chip in a lego robot.
